WATER AMENDMENT ACT 2006 No. 23 - SECT 21

21 Insertion of new ch 9, pt 5, div 6

After section 1139--

insert--

In this division--

amending Act means the Water Amendment Act 2006.

commencement means the date of assent of the amending Act.

'(1) Despite not having been given advice by the commission under section 360I(1), 12 the Minister may make a report mentioned in section 360M(1)(a)13 and a regional water security program that adopts all or part of a relevant existing strategy.

'(2) If the Minister adopts all or part of a relevant existing strategy as a regional water security program the commission can not give regional water security options for the region the subject of the program, other than under a requirement under section 360D(1)(b).14

'(3) Subsection (4) applies for the SEQ region or a designated region only if the Minister has not made a regional water security program for the region that adopts all or part of a relevant existing strategy.

'(4) In preparing regional water security options for the region, the commission may have regard to and use all or part of a relevant existing strategy.

'(4A) Subsections (4B) and (4C) apply if, because of subsection (2), no regional water security options have been given for the region.

'(4B) The Minister may, by gazette notice, require the commission to give regional water options for the region for the purpose of updating or revising the region's regional water security program.

'(4C) For chapter 2A, a requirement under subsection (4B) is taken to be a requirement under section 360D(1)(b).

'(5) In this section--

relevant existing strategy means--

(a) for the SEQ region--the series of documents prepared by the department and local governments for the project called 'South East Queensland regional water supply strategy', the preparation of which started before the commencement; or
(b) for a designated region--any series of documents (however called) prepared by the department and local governments about a regional water supply strategy for the region, the preparation of which started before the commencement.

The amendments to sections 110 and 17815 made under the amending Act apply for a licence mentioned in the sections whether the licence was granted before or after the commencement.

The condition under section 360N(5)16 does not apply to a development approval granted before the commencement.'.
